4 / 14 page ![]() M14C64, M14C32 4/14 Memory Addressing To start communication between the bus master and the slave memory, the master must initiate a START condition. Following this, the master sends 8 bits to the SDA bus line (with the most significant bit first). These bits represent the Device Select Code (7 bits) and a RW bit. The seven most significant bits of the Device Se- lect Code are the Device Type Identifier, according to the I2C bus definition. For the memory device, Figure 5.
